Bollywood Actor Ahuja Out on Bail Following Rape Conviction, Sentencing

NEW DELHI -- Bollywood actor Shiney Ahuja, 38, was granted bail by the Bombay High Court Wednesday in an ongoing case where he was given a seven-year jail term last month for raping his maid. The actor was asked to post a bail amount of 50,000 rupees ($1,100).

The court also restricted Ahuja's travel outside India without permission and the actor will have to present himself to investigating agencies whenever required.

In his appeal, Ahuja had claimed that he had been falsely implicated in the case after he was first arrested in June 2009, following allegations by his maid that he raped her in his Mumbai home. Ahuja was first granted bail in October 2009 on the condition that he stay away from Mumbai until the case came to trial. Ahuja returned to his family home in Delhi with his wife and daughter.

Still on the rise, Ahuja made his film debut with 2004's?acclaimed arthouse release Hazaaron Khwaishein Aisi?(A?Thousand Desires) followed by mainstream outings like 2006's Gangster. Among his upcoming projects is horror?film The Accident?produced by Mumbai-based banner?Pritish Nandy Communications and U.K.-based High Point?Media.
